The value of an electronic reader is related to the availability of books, journals, magazines, etc. in a format that can be used in the electronic reader. For an electronic reader, these are _____ goods.

Answer:

Complementary

Explanation:

A complementary product is a product whose use relates to the use of a similar or paired product.

Two products (A and B) complement each other if more of good A allows more good B to be used. In this instance, the electronic reader (Product A), requires the use of e-books and journals(Product B) to function.

The demand for one printers, for instance, produces demand for the other (ink cartridges). When the value of a product drops and people buy more of it, they typically buy more of the additional good as well, whether or not their price also falls.
